The Big Pig Project is RVA’s biggest BBQ block party, where everyone (kids and dogs too!) is invited to come out and enjoy a fun day supporting the Ronald McDonald House of Richmond! The party kicks off at Lunch and Supper in Scott’s Addition at 11:00 AM on Saturday with The Brunch Market, featuring local vendors selling art, jewelry, bath products, pottery, crafts, and more! At 12:00 the kid’s activities get fired up with arts and crafts and a bounce house! Soon after the live music starts followed by the first auction, a cooking demonstration, more music, and a whole lot of fun! Craft beer, mimosas, and bloody marys are on tap to quench your thirst along with delicious BBQ (duh) to keep you full! Things will start winding down around 6:00 so get there early!

The RVA Earth Day festival is going down on Saturday too! This street festival will feature local artists, bands, chefs, food trucks, breweries, and environmentalists, all with a goal to celebrate our planet and educate Richmonders on how we can all take steps to care for it a little more! Learn about locally available sustainable products and services while shopping local vendors, eating and drinking RVA’s best, and enjoying live music. Swing by the kids area for art and other fun activities! You can also take part in the “Race Without A Trace” Earth Day 5k! The festival takes place in Manchester at 24 E 3rd St.
